Quite a setback of recent, I thought golf, by now, would again be an active part of my life. My chest has been severely painful while I am a passenger in a car. Every pothole, & who can argue they are everywhere, creates a shriek from me, as does turning corners too quickly or stopping suddenly when a light turns yellow. I went to see about this in emergency at the Ottawa General in late March after returning from Toronto, because I was certain the chest pain wasn`t normal. They probed me up & down, did xrays, a CT scan & after ONLY 13 hours, said all was okay. Strange, but I just didn`t believe them! The severe pain in the chest area persisted, even got worse, when trying to go anywhere by car on Ottawa`s streets. On June 1, I returned to Toronto for a day of clinic testing + a bronchoscopy (which I am committed to every 3 months in the 1st year following the surgery), told the clinic doctor I was in a lot of pain when trying to lift my arms above my shoulders, bending over, or especially while driving in a car. They contacted 1 of the surgeons in the Transplant Team, he joined with a 2nd surgeon + a radiologist & after reviewing my newest x-rays & CT scan they discovered vertebrae compression or stress fractures, an old one which the Ottawa General had missed + a new one, which they feel has been caused by the steroids I am taking as part of my anti-rejection medication. Now I am taking even more drugs, to correct the other drugs I am already on. I can almost feel the war going on inside of me. The plus side, if this bone stuff ever gets healed up, is that my breathing tests are fabulous. The transplanted lungs are working beautifully. The recent testing showed me at 126% of their target mark for a guy my age for the 6 minute walk test & the pulmonary function testing showed me at 106% of their target mark. The blood work & the bronchoscopy also produced excellent results. The crappy part of these fractures is that the 1st words spoken from the woman who runs the Transplant Physio Department were to forget about golf for this year, too much torque is involved in a full swing (driver & other woods) & it will probably take months for full healing. Google lists the healing at 8 -12 weeks.
